Palampur: DAV Public School, Palampur, has once again upheld its tradition of academic excellence, securing a 100% pass result in the CBSE Class XII and Class X board examinations for the academic session 2024–25. The school has reported an outstanding performance across both grades, with a significant number of students achieving distinction and first division scores.

In Class XII, 89 students appeared for the board exams. Among them, 9 students scored above 90%, and 23 students secured more than 80%. A total of 81 students passed with first division marks (above 60%), highlighting the consistent academic strength of the school.

In Class X, 135 students appeared for the exams. Of these, 16 students scored above 90%, 54 scored above 80%, and 114 students passed with first division.
